Comprehending the Role of a Door Hinge TechnicianA Door Hinge Technician is specialized in installing, fixing, and preserving door hinge systems, which are vital parts for door operation. The role requires a keen eye for information, mechanical aptitude, and knowledge of various door types and their corresponding hinge systems. This specialization plays an essential role in ensuring the performance, resilience, and aesthetic appeal of doors in residential, commercial, and industrial settings.

Here are a few of the most essential ones:
- Technical Proficiency: Understanding numerous hinge systems and installation techniques.
- Problem-Solving Skills: Ability to identify concerns quickly and propose efficient solutions.
- Attention to Detail: Ensuring accurate measurements and positionings for door performance.
- Physical Stamina: The role often requires raising heavy doors and working in different positions.
- Interaction Skills: Ability to engage with customers, understand their requirements, and explain technical principles plainly.

1. How do I understand if I need a brand-new door hinge?
If your door is squeaking, not closing effectively, or revealing noticeable indications of wear and tear on the hinge, it might be time to consult a Door Hinge Technician.
2. Can I set up door hinges myself?
While some people may have the skills to install hinges on their own, it is suggested to hire a professional for ideal results, specifically for heavier doors or intricate systems.
3. What kinds of hinges are there?
There are various types of hinges, consisting of:
- Butt hinges
- Constant hinges (piano hinges)
- Concealed hinges
- Pivot hinges
- Magnetic hinges
4. Just how read more does it cost to employ a Door Hinge Technician?
Expenses differ depending on place, intricacy, and the technician's experience, but it normally ranges from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150 per hour for labor. Product costs will be additional.
5. How often should door hinges be maintained?
Regular maintenance is advised a minimum of as soon as a year. Nevertheless, if you notice any problems before that, it's smart to speak with a technician as soon as possible.
